The Secret Language of Bird of Paradise Flowers: Unraveling Their Symbolism and Meanings

Bird of Paradise Flower Meanings & Symbolism

The bird of paradise, which originated in South Africa and is now a common flower in tropical regions all over the world, is connected to numerous uplifting traits and some spiritual implications. Learn everything there is to know about the cultural significance of the bird of paradise in this article.

Detailed Meaning of Bird of Paradise

Freedom

Because of how the bird of paradise looks to a graceful, long-necked bird, it is frequently referred to as a crane flower. Its long stem and vibrant blossoms resemble the head of a bird with a plume of brilliant flowers on it and a sharp beak. These enchanted blooms develop in clusters that resemble a flock of colorful tropical birds poised for flight. Consequently, the bird of paradise flower represents freedom.

Opportunity

This indigenous South African shrub also represents potential. South Africa, a country where one set of people historically held sway over another, has luckily undergone a societal transformation. Freedom and fresh possibilities are more accessible than ever right now. The bird of paradise thus stands for fresh liberties and the potential for wealth.

Identity and Uniqueness

Some species of bird of paradise can soar as high as 20 feet. The bird of paradise is a flower that stands out from other flowers due to its peculiar blossoms, which also represent individuality and uniqueness.

This unique blossom represents the self-assurance needed to be unique. They therefore make fantastic presents for a person in your life who is discovering their special path and personal identity as an individual.

Glamour

The fact that the bird of paradise is the city flower of Los Angeles, California, shouldn’t be shocking. The vibrant bird of paradise is without a doubt the flower that best captures the glitz and glamour of Hollywood and the sunny beaches, stunning sunsets, and lovely skies.

Faithfulness

In the animal realm, most birds are monogamous. So, it makes sense that a flower named after a pretty bird represents constancy in relationships. The bird of paradise is also the customary gift for couples who are commemorating their ninth wedding anniversary.

Joy

Its vivid hues and tropical bird of paradise also represent joy due to its natural environment in bright sunshine. This flower has the appearance of having been made specifically to revive people’s spirits. Additionally, the bird of paradise serves as a tropical flower to help us remember to relax and have fun, as on a tropical vacation.

Paradise

As suggested by its name, this beautiful flower also represents paradise. The bird of paradise serves as a reminder that we live in a paradise on Earth. It also serves as a reminder that we may cultivate paradise in our own lives.

Spiritual Meaning of Bird of Paradise

The bird of paradise symbolizes reaching for a more heavenly or elevated spiritual state. The flower’s protracted stalk serves as a metaphor for spiritual ascent and the pursuit of enlightenment.

Bird of Paradise Flower – What is it?

The exotic flower known as the tropical perennial bird of paradise grows in tropical and subtropical climates, flourishing best in USDA Hardiness Zones 10–12 (and perhaps Zone 9 if given the right care and protection).

These evergreen plants like warmth and humidity and keep their leaves all year long. Bird of Paradise flowers come in five different varieties, yet they all have the same name.

Appearance of Bird of Paradise flower

The flowers known as the bird of paradise are modeled after the bird-of-paradise, a kind of bird that inhabits the tropical woods of Australia and the nearby islands. The bodies of male bird-of-flowers are covered with colorful feathers.

The flower of the Bird of Paradise plant has petals that closely resemble a bird in flight, especially the head, where some of the petals resemble beaks. The flowers are usually vividly colored, coming in threes from broad, boat-shaped bracts.

It is a tropical plant related to the banana plant that can reach heights of 4 to 6 feet (1.2 to 1.8 meters) and widths of up to 5 feet (1.5 meters). The enormous bird of paradise, however, is a species that may reach heights of 30 feet.

Which places are native to Bird of Paradise?

Native to South Africa, notably the subtropical coastal regions, are plants known as birds of paradise. This flower, which is a member of the Strelitziaceae family, has spread naturally throughout North, Central, and South America. It is regarded as Portugal’s national flower.

How to grow Bird of Paradise Flower

Although they are very simple to cultivate and maintain, bird of paradise flowers like a lot of natural sunlight, especially when planted indoors. They can handle some shade, though.

The flower enjoys lots of water and does best in warm, humid settings. As they are prone to root rot (especially if grown in a pot), it is preferable to let the soil almost entirely dry before watering it again. Soil with good drainage is ideal for them.

Years are needed for a bird of paradise flowers to develop and blossom. In actuality, it may take your plant up to four years to yield the vivid, bright blooms that give it its name. The ideal temperature range for the flower is between 65 and 85 degrees Fahrenheit. You shouldn’t keep the plant outside in cooler months or even on unusually chilly summer evenings because anything below 55 to 60 degrees Fahrenheit can destroy the plant.

Since bird of paradise plants need a variety of nutrients to continue developing and eventually blossom, using the appropriate fertilizer can help them grow. A balanced organic fertilizer with a 1-1-1 NPK (n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ium) ratio is advised by the majority of specialists. Every few months, fertilize the plant. As you spot dead leaves and faded blossoms, prune them.

Symbolism and Meaning of Bird of Paradise

Independence and Freedom

Bird of paradise flowers, as was already noted, look like birds in flight. They are frequently connected with independence and freedom because of this. This plant serves as a reminder that, like birds, we are not captive. We can always break out and investigate our limitless possibilities.

Joy and Laughter

Bird of paradise plants’ vivid hues frequently evoke happiness and gladness. When in full bloom, the flower brightens up any area it grows in with its vivid yellows, oranges, and reds.

Bliss and Paradise

Plants known as bird of paradise are symbolic of paradise, whatever that may be to you. What does bliss mean to you? Perhaps you’re spending a rainy day inside with a cup of coffee, or perhaps you and your lover are vacationing on a balmy island. Whatever the reason, this flower’s stunningly colorful flowers give us a taste of paradise.

Success and Abundance

The bird of paradise plant is regarded as a lucky and prosperous symbol in many cultures. Its vibrant blossoms and commanding presence symbolize enthusiasm and good fortune for you.

Loyalty and Love

The bird of paradise, the official flower of the ninth wedding anniversary, denotes intense devotion and romantic love. The flower is the ideal bouquet for lovers because many people think the plant stands for faithfulness and commitment.
